Centrally located in the city, close to public transport, there is a café onsite for employees to enjoy and the nearby aquatic center and gym offer great rates for employees.About the RoleThis is a unique opportunity that combines business analysis, service design and change adoption to support technology projects covering application development and implementation as well as broadcast and IT infrastructure upgrades and initiatives.The Principal Business Readiness Analyst will lead the provision of expert analysis on complex technology-based business systems and processes and advise on workflow, service and human centred design to ensure the business is prepared for the changes and adopts the improvements to benefit the wider ABC.The Principal Business Analyst is a key member of the Business Readiness Practice team within the Product & Technology division. The team includes business analysts, change managers, learning and design specialists.The role will support the Business Readiness Practice Manager by leading the development of concept briefs, contributing to business cases, driving consistent standards, tools and templates for the practice and mentoring colleagues.This includes:
- Providing expert business analysis, service design and change advice to address complex technology-based business needs and processes including the design and implementation of technology enabled business solutions.
- Scoping, planning and scheduling business readiness activities to ensure effective delivery of project activation plans and support adoption of change.
- Assisting the Business Readiness Practice Manager to build capability among team members and colleagues on project delivery and emerging trends.
- Carrying out requirements gathering, documentation and analysis of data, technology systems, business processes and people impacts
- Maintaining effective communication with stakeholders; reporting progress and addressing issues and risks promptly to facilitate speedy resolution to maintain agreed timelines for completion.
- Working in large complex development projects is mandatory.
- Extensive expertise in analysis of complex IT systems, business processes and people impacts, with proven experience in service design and delivering change.
- Exceptional ability to apply theoretical technical, process and people related concepts to business requirements including user experience and human centred design approaches.
- Demonstrated ability to provide expert knowledge to management, stakeholders and users.
- Demonstrated ability to take a lead in project teams, coaching and contributing to the development of practice processes and mentoring staff.
- Strong written and verbal communications skills, including the ability to convey or translate complex technical information to target audiences.
